Having just Purchased 2014 Q5 TDI Prestige Trim with the S line package this past weekend for my wife the fit and finish as in all Audis is excellent. Also owning a fully loaded Q7 Sline that has now logged in over 100K miles since we bought it new in late 2006 when most people weren't even aware that Audi made an SUV I can attest to the vast improvements they have made in the last 7 years. It may not be at the Porsche level trims but I would rather own a vehicle that people see as a resemblance to a Porsche than pay $20-$30K for a similarly equipped Cayenne and Macan. Plus the TDI has enormous torque at 428 ft pounds and gets on average over 30 miles a gallon.

The Macan is a big relief here as both S petrol and S diesel models are $3-5k cheaper than the Audi SQ5.
We're shopping right now. I wish the Macan was available for immediate delivery. We have driven the Audi SQ5 and the BMW X3 xdrive35. We're leaning towards the SQ5 at this point. It seems to be very well made and very nice.
The SQ5 is great! I love the exhaust note.

I wouldn't say they are amazing.....iDrive is by far my favorite interface, but I would say that Audi has more functionality than both Porsche and BMW, better nav routing, and more functionality. BMW has more apps though.
I suppose they were amazing to me when I compare them to my 10 year old Cayenne! I mean, I love CDs as much as the next guy, but I'm ready to move on to newer technology. I liked the HUD display, lane change warning system, etc. in the BMW. It had a larger nav screen too, which was nice. It was pretty quick too!
I still prefer the Audi overall though.

For the short period that I have owned my '11 S4, it was trouble free, but the interior is far from desirable compared to my '09 C4S with full leather interior. I have looked at the SQ5 when it was first launched last year at the local dealer. There seems to be a lot of parts sharing between the S4 and SQ5, so it still feels like there is a lot plastic / fake leather in the car.
